    In the 2025 elections, voters will choose who will fill more than 18,000 local positions: (Provinces) 82 governors, 82 vice governors, 840 board members; (Cities) 149 mayors, 149 vice mayors, 1,690 councilors; (Municipalities) 1,493 mayors, 1,493 vice mayors, 11,948 councilors; 254 representatives; (BARMM Parliament) 65 members, party representatives.

    San Leonardo


    April 2025

    San Leonardo is a 1st-class municipality in the Philippines. It is part of Nueva Ecija in Central Luzon, located in Luzon. It has a population of 68,536 as of the 2020 Census, and a land area of 151.90 square kilometers. It consists of 15 barangays. In the 2025 elections, the municipality has 45,858 registered voters.
